Drinking six to eight 8-ounce glasses of water daily can also help … WebMar 14, 2024 · Simple cystitis (uncomplicated urinary tract infection) often doesn’t cause headache and fatigue except in rare cases. The presence of fatigue and fever may indicate a more severe form of urinary tract infection (UTI) called pyelonephritis. WebJan 5, 2024 · A UTI is an infection in any part of the urinary system, including the bladder, kidneys, and urethra. UTIs can cause a wide range of symptoms, including pain when urinating, a burning sensation when urinating, feeling like you have to urinate all the time, blood in the urine, and pelvic pain. WebMar 10, 2024 · Urinary tract infections (UTIs) can usually be treated with antibiotics, but there are times when the drugs are unable to fully clear the infection. If a UTI comes back right after taking an antibiotic, it may be due to problems with how the drugs were taken. WebAn uncomplicated urinary tract infection may cause mild to moderate suprapubic pain, a type of pain that most patients experience as a feeling of pressure or discomfort just above … WebAug 6, 2024 · Make an appointment with your health care provider if you have symptoms of a kidney infection. Also see your provider if you're being treated for a UTI but your symptoms aren't getting better. A severe kidney infection can lead to dangerous complications. They may include blood poisoning, damage to the body's tissues or death.
